Authenticated database access via unsanitized agent identifier
Published Jul 25, 2025 · Updated Jul 25, 2025
SQL injection in updateAgent.php in itsourcecode.com Insurance Management System 1.0 allows remote authenticated users to read and alter stored data. The handler places the POST agent_id value into a MySQL query without sanitization or validation, permitting boolean-, error-, and time-based query manipulation. A valid login and session cookie are required; successful exploitation supports unauthorized database reads and changes, while broader host control is not established.
